A tense phone call between U.S. President Donald Trump and Israeli PM Benjamin Netanyahu has spotlighted growing divisions over Israel’s military operations in Lebanon. Trump reportedly urged a ceasefire to prevent further escalation and protect ongoing negotiations involving Iran.However, Netanyahu is said to have maintained that Israel will continue strikes if Hezbollah attacks persist on Israeli territory. Amid the escalating tensions, Israeli Foreign Ministry spokesperson Oren Marmorstein stated that Israeli families remain under attack and emphasized that Israel does not seek war with Lebanon but is acting in self-defence against Hezbollah.“We don’t want a war with Lebanon or on the northern border. We are defending ourselves from Hezbollah. Iran is holding Lebanon hostage,” Marmorstein said.The developments have intensified concerns over a wider regional conflict in West Asia.
